WebNov 30, 2024 · Public engagement requested on food and beverage strategy. November 30, 2024. 8:59 pm. The Government of Nova Scotia is developing a food and beverage strategy to outline policies, programs and initiatives that help raise awareness of, improve access to, and increase the production of healthy local food. WebNov 25, 2024 · met with close to 100 key partners involved in the food system, including primary producers, retail partners and food banks. This information, along with input from Nova Scotians, will be used to develop the food and beverage strategy. Public engagement opens today, November 25, and continues through December 23. WebDec 14, 2024 · The Nova Scotia government is rolling out a new pilot project designed to help bring more local food to communities. The $250,000 program will provide incentives to large kitchens that emphasize using food from local farms. Northwood, a 385-resident long-term care facility in Halifax, will be the first location to receive support from the ...
